**Ticket #: Guest Wi-Fi Desk — Reception, Carverton Works**

A dedicated guest Wi-Fi sign-in desk has been set up at main reception for visiting contractors working on the Pellbrook fit-out. Contractors should check in on arrival, present photo ID, and collect a day pass before connecting any equipment. The desk is staffed 08:30–17:00 on weekdays. To open the reception side gate when the desk is unattended, enter the pass code shown below.

staff pass of fahif-tajop = bdg-GRDHE-5

Hey, handover for the record-dedup work on Clambake:

The dedup pipeline merges customer records nightly using fuzzy matching on name plus postcode prefix. It's conservative on purpose — borderline pairs go to a review queue instead of auto-merging, and that queue is where most of the maintenance pain lives. Watch the false-merge rate after any matcher tweak; we got burned once. Undo tooling exists but is slow. Matcher weights, queue triage tips, and the rollback procedure are all written up on the internal page here.

dashboard of yahaf-kajep = https://jira.zemvarsys.internal/display/projects/browse/browse/a08b

Runbook: Catalog Cache Invalidation (Pricewharf)

When product edits don't show up on the storefront, the usual cause is a stale entry in the Lanternfish cache layer. First, confirm the item version in the admin console matches the catalog database. If it doesn't, trigger a targeted purge via the invalidation CLI rather than flushing the whole region — full flushes hammer the origin for about ten minutes. The CLI authenticates against the purge endpoint, so your local .env must include this line before anything works:

env line for yajep-bajof: ARCHIVE_KEY3=015